Calculate Number of Days Between Two Dates Using Days – Professional Calculator


Calculate Number of Days Between Two Dates Using Days

A precise tool designed to help you calculate number of days between two dates using days. Whether for project management, legal deadlines, or travel planning, get instant results for total days, business days, and time breakdowns.


Select the initial date for your range.
Please select a valid start date.


Select the final date for your range.
Please select a valid end date.



Total Duration
0 Days
Formula: (End Date – Start Date)
Years, Months, Days: 0 Years, 0 Months, 0 Days
Weeks and Days: 0 Weeks and 0 Days
Working Days (Mon-Fri): 0 Days
Percent of Year: 0%

Visual Comparison: Day Types

Working Days vs Weekends

Relative to 365 Days

Green: Working Days | Blue: Total Progress of Year

Unit of Time Total Count Description
Total Days 0 The absolute count of days in the range.
Total Hours 0 Calculated as Total Days × 24.
Total Minutes 0 Calculated as Total Days × 1,440.
Total Seconds 0 Calculated as Total Days × 86,400.

What is Calculate Number of Days Between Two Dates Using Days?

To calculate number of days between two dates using days is a fundamental mathematical and administrative task that involves determining the precise span of time between a start point and an end point on the calendar. This process is more complex than simple subtraction because it must account for varying month lengths, leap years, and whether the start or end dates are inclusive.

Who should use this? Project managers use it to track milestones; HR professionals use it to calculate tenure or leave; and students use it to manage study schedules. A common misconception is that every month has 30 days, or that calculating weeks is as simple as dividing by seven without considering the remainder. Our tool eliminates these errors by using standardized ISO date logic to calculate number of days between two dates using days accurately every time.

Calculate Number of Days Between Two Dates Using Days Formula and Mathematical Explanation

The core logic to calculate number of days between two dates using days relies on converting dates into a serial numeric format (usually Unix timestamps) and calculating the delta. Here is the step-by-step derivation:

  • Step 1: Convert both the Start Date and End Date into milliseconds since the Epoch (January 1, 1970).
  • Step 2: Subtract the Start Date milliseconds from the End Date milliseconds.
  • Step 3: Divide the result by the number of milliseconds in a single day (86,400,000).
  • Step 4: If the “Include End Date” option is selected, add 1 to the final result.
Variable Meaning Unit Typical Range
D1 Start Date Date Object Any valid calendar date
D2 End Date Date Object D1 or later
T_ms Milliseconds per Day Integer 86,400,000
Result Total Days Integer 0 to 100,000+

Practical Examples (Real-World Use Cases)

Example 1: Project Deadline
A project starts on January 1, 2024, and must be completed by March 15, 2024. If you calculate number of days between two dates using days for this range, the result is 74 days. If the company includes the launch day itself, the total becomes 75 days. This helps in resource allocation and setting daily productivity targets.

Example 2: Financial Interest Calculation
Suppose you have a short-term loan that spans from June 10th to August 20th. To calculate the interest owed, you first need to calculate number of days between two dates using days. The duration is 71 days. At a daily interest rate, knowing this exact count is vital for financial accuracy.

How to Use This Calculate Number of Days Between Two Dates Using Days Calculator

Our interface is designed for maximum efficiency. Follow these steps:

  1. Enter the Start Date: Use the date picker to select when your period begins.
  2. Enter the End Date: Select the conclusion of your period. The tool handles future and past dates.
  3. Toggle Inclusion: Check the “Include end date” box if you want to count the final day as a full day of duration.
  4. Read the Results: The primary result shows the total days, while the secondary results break it down into weeks, months, and even working days.
  5. Analyze the Chart: Use the visual bar to see how much of a calendar year this duration occupies.

Key Factors That Affect Calculate Number of Days Between Two Dates Using Days Results

  • Leap Years: Every four years, February has 29 days. Failing to account for this can lead to a 1-day error in long-term calculations.
  • Time Zones: When you calculate number of days between two dates using days across different time zones, the “day” might start earlier or later, potentially shifting the result.
  • Inclusion Logic: Whether you count the first day, the last day, or both is a matter of convention (e.g., “7 days from today” could mean the same day next week).
  • Business Days: Weekends (Saturdays and Sundays) often need to be excluded for commercial contracts.
  • Public Holidays: Unlike standard weekends, holidays vary by region and year, requiring custom logic for “working day” counts.
  • Daylight Savings: When the clock shifts, a “day” might technically be 23 or 25 hours long, though for calendar day counts, this is usually ignored.

Frequently Asked Questions (FAQ)

Does this tool account for leap years?
Yes, when you calculate number of days between two dates using days, our system automatically detects leap years (like 2024 or 2028) and adds the extra day in February if the range crosses it.

What is the difference between “total days” and “business days”?
Total days includes every day on the calendar (Monday through Sunday). Business days typically only count Monday through Friday.

Can I calculate days in the past?
Absolutely. You can select any historical dates to find the duration between two past events.

Why would I include the end date?
In many industries, like hotel bookings or rentals, the “stay” or “use” includes the final day. Including the end date ensures that the span is inclusive of both boundary dates.

How are “Months” calculated in the breakdown?
We use a calendar-accurate method that accounts for the specific number of days in each month (28, 29, 30, or 31) rather than a flat 30-day average.

Is there a limit to the date range?
There is no practical limit; however, very distant dates (thousands of years apart) may vary based on historical calendar shifts (Julian vs Gregorian).

How do I copy my results?
Simply click the “Copy Results” button to save the text breakdown to your clipboard for use in emails or documents.

Can I use this for payroll?
Yes, many users use this to calculate number of days between two dates using days to determine pro-rated salaries or leave balances.

© 2023 Date Duration Expert. All rights reserved.



Leave a Reply

Your email address will not be published. Required fields are marked *